If Drawn Upright

The World card is a powerful symbol of completion, wholeness, and integration. When this card appears, it signifies that you have reached a significant milestone in your journey, and you are on the verge of achieving a state of fulfillment and harmony. The ethereal goddess depicted in the card represents the divine feminine energy and the cosmic wisdom that guides your path. She holds the world in her hand, signifying your ability to shape and create your own reality. The presence of the completed worlds in the background suggests that you have already accomplished great things and have the potential to manifest even more in the future. The World card advises you to embrace the sense of accomplishment and acknowledge the growth and transformation you have experienced. Celebrate your achievements and the wisdom you have gained along the way. Take a moment to reflect on how far you have come and the lessons you have learned. At the same time, the image of the goddess working to balance and build the worlds reminds you that your journey is ongoing. It encourages you to continue expanding your horizons and exploring new possibilities. Embrace the idea that there are always new experiences, knowledge, and opportunities awaiting you.

The World card advises you to maintain a sense of balance and harmony in your life. Seek equilibrium between your personal and professional life, your spiritual and physical well-being, and your inner and outer worlds. By finding this balance, you can navigate challenges with grace and integrate all aspects of your being. This card also invites you to consider the interconnectedness of all things. Recognize the impact of your actions and choices on the world around you. Embrace a sense of responsibility and use your power and influence wisely. You have the ability to make a positive difference, not only in your own life but also in the lives of others and the world at large.

The World card encourages you to embrace the concept of wholeness within yourself. Recognize that you are a unique and complete being, capable of fulfilling your potential. Trust in your abilities and have confidence in your capacity to create the life you desire. Embrace the infinite possibilities that lie before you. Be open to new experiences, cultures, and perspectives. Allow yourself to step outside of your comfort zone and explore uncharted territories. The World card reminds you that the world is your playground, and you have the freedom to create your own reality.

If Drawn In Reverse

When the World card appears in reverse, it suggests a temporary delay or a sense of being stuck in a particular phase of your journey. It may indicate that you are experiencing obstacles or challenges that are preventing you from reaching a state of completion or fulfillment. The image of the goddess holding the world in her hand, along with the other completed worlds in the background, takes on a different meaning in reverse. It may signify a lack of progress or a feeling of being overwhelmed by the tasks at hand. The unfinished world in the background may represent unfinished projects or unresolved issues that need your attention.

The reversed World card advises you to examine any areas of your life where you feel stagnant or limited. Reflect on whether there are self-imposed limitations, fear, or resistance holding you back. It may be necessary to reassess your goals and make necessary adjustments to move forward.

This card encourages you to look within and identify any limiting beliefs or patterns that are hindering your growth. Consider if you are clinging to outdated ways of thinking or if you are afraid to step outside of your comfort zone. 

The reversed World card reminds you to be patient and gentle with yourself during this phase. It is okay to take a step back and reassess your direction. Use this time to reflect on your priorities, gain clarity, and make any necessary changes to realign yourself with your true purpose. It is important to address any unfinished business or unresolved issues in your life. The reversed World card may indicate that there are loose ends that need to be tied up before you can move forward. Take the time to complete any outstanding tasks, heal any past wounds, or make amends if needed.

Be mindful of the potential for self-sabotage or the fear of success. The reversed World card may indicate that you are hesitant to embrace your full potential or afraid of the responsibilities that come with it. It is essential to confront these fears and work through them, allowing yourself to step into your power and shine. Remember that the World card in reverse is not a permanent state but rather a temporary phase. It serves as a reminder that growth and progress often come with challenges and setbacks. Embrace the lessons and opportunities for growth that arise during this time, and trust that you have the inner strength and resilience to overcome any obstacles.
